Output 151ce4df2bf4b71574c5c02402fd2a14e1c74fbdbc55ffd71a13a968a61daf29:2

value
99051932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c7ab1e7e8cbc3b8bb9ca13a967f531a1ea065c OP_EQUAL
address
MEG83sZLextzjeMe9ARuSVoBCCvJvcXeFm
transaction
151ce4df2bf4b71574c5c02402fd2a14e1c74fbdbc55ffd71a13a968a61daf29
spent
true